引言

          在当今的数字货币领域,以太坊作为一种流行的区块链平台,不仅支持智能合约的执行,还允许用户进行数字资产的转账。很多用户在使用以太坊钱包进行转账时,可能会对其中的验证原理感到好奇。本文将深入探讨以太坊钱包转账的过程、验证机制及其重要性。

          以太坊钱包和转账的基本概念

          深入了解以太坊钱包转账的验证原理

          在讨论以太坊转账的验证原理之前,我们首先需要了解以太坊钱包的基本概念。以太坊钱包是存储以太币(ETH)和其他基于以太坊的代币的工具。它可以是软件、硬件,甚至纸质形式。

          转账则是指在以太坊网络中,从一个钱包地址向另一个钱包地址发送以太币或其他代币的过程。转账通常需要支付一定的交易费用,这被称为“Gas费”。

          以太坊转账的流程

          以太坊转账的过程可以分为几个主要步骤:

          1. 创建转账请求:用户在其钱包中输入接收方地址和转账金额。
          2. 签署交易:用户使用其私钥对交易进行签名,以确保只有资产的所有者才能发起转账。
          3. 广播交易:交易被发送到以太坊网络,其他节点将接收到这笔交易。
          4. 矿工验证:矿工将交易打包到区块中,并进行验证。
          5. 区块确认:一旦区块被添加到链上,转账完成,接收方钱包将收到相应的金额。

          转账的验证机制

          深入了解以太坊钱包转账的验证原理

          验证在转账过程中至关重要。它不仅保证了交易的合法性,还确保了网络的安全性。以下是转账验证的几个关键要素:

          1. 交易签名

          每个转账请求都必须被发起者签名。签名过程使用的是公钥密码学。只有拥有私钥的用户才能签署交易。验证者通过公钥来确认签名的有效性,从而验证交易的来源。

          2. 账户余额检查

          在执行转账之前,网络会检查发起者账户中的余额。如果余额不足,则交易将被拒绝。这是为了防止用户发送超过他们账户中可用余额的资产。

          3. Gas 费用的支付

          每笔交易都需要支付Gas费用。如果用户设置的Gas限制不足以执行转账,或者Gas价格不符合当前网络的费用标准,交易将无法被处理。矿工只会验证和打包那些费用合理的交易。

          4. 共识机制

          以太坊目前采用的是工作量证明(Proof of Work)机制,即新区块的创建依赖于矿工的计算能力。而未来,以太坊2.0将转向权益证明(Proof of Stake)机制,这将改进网络的验证效率和安全性。

          以太坊转账的安全性

          安全性是转账过程中的另一重要因素。为了保护用户的资产,以太坊网络采取了多种安全措施:

          1. 帐号和私钥管理

          用户应该妥善管理其钱包的私钥。失去私钥,用户将无法访问其资产。此外,硬件钱包提供了额外的安全性,防止恶意软件的攻击。

          2. 防止重放攻击

          重放攻击是指攻击者在多个区块链上进行同一笔交易,从而造成损失。以太坊通过使用 nonce(交易序号)来防止这种情况的发生。每笔交易的 nonce 在同一地址下是唯一的,这保证了每笔交易只会被处理一次。

          3. 网络效应

          以太坊网络的去中心化性质提高了其安全性。由于交易需要大量矿工的共识,因此难以通过单一实体篡改交易记录。这确保了交易的透明性和不可篡改性。

          总结

          以太坊钱包转账的验证原理是其安全性和稳定性的基础。了解这个过程不仅可以帮助用户更好地管理自己的资产,还能提升他们在使用以太坊生态系统中的信心。随着以太坊技术的不断发展和演变,转账过程中的验证机制也将不断,为用户提供更加安全快捷的体验。

          未来的展望

          未来,以太坊将继续引领区块链技术的发展。随着以太坊2.0的推出,转账验证的效率将得到显著提升,用户体验也将进一步。我们期待以太坊在全球范围内实现更广泛的应用场景,推动数字资产的安全流通与发展。

          总的来说,理解以太坊钱包转账的验证原理,能够帮助用户在这个数字时代更好地参与到加密货币的浪潮中。希望本文对大家有所帮助。